Job Description
As a Property & Asset Management Analyst, you will review and update records in the property database, ensuring information is accurate and up to date. You will help prepare periodic and special reports on property and material reviews, physical inventory planning, contract annual government property records (AGPR), PIEE GFP module status and other reports. You will engage with internal and external customers, including government regulatory agencies.
This position will work a 9/80 schedule, with every other Friday off.
Your Role and Impact:
• Coordinate and collaborate property surveillance reviews and annual physical inventories at supplier and subcontractor sites
• Collaborate with Buyers, Subcontracts Administrators and Program and Functional area Property Focal Points (PFPs) to ensure accountability of assets are maintained
• Lead Property Management System Analysis (PMSA) reviews, Contractor Self-Assessment (CSA) reviews, Mission Assurance audits and AS9100 audits
• Assist program management in the planning and execution of the property management life cycle
• Maintain property accountability records, determining condition of assets and arranging disposal of surplus or obsolete material
• Other duties as assigned

Basic Qualifications:
• Bachelor's degree with 5 years of professional experience - OR - Master's degree with 3 years of professional experience - OR - PhD with 1 year of professional experience. Will consider an additional 4+ years of experience in lieu of degree.
• Requires an active U.S. Government DoD Secret security clearance at time of application, current and within scope
• Experience with MS Office, including MS Excel
• Property and asset management experience
• Ability to travel, up to 25% of the time, as needed per business needs
Preferred Qualifications:
• Government property and asset management experience
• SAP experience
• Aerospace or Defense industry experience
• Experience with federal regulations, FAR 52-245-1 and DFAR
• National Property Management Association certification (NPMA - CPPS, NPMA - CPPA, NPMA-CPPM)
• Experience in Wide Area Workflow, including PIEE (Procurement Integration Enterprise Environment)
Physical Requirements:
• Ability to lift up to 50 pounds
• Ability to drive box truck and forklift
• Must be willing to become forklift certified
